What are some common hidden meanings and symbolism associated with black paint?

Black paint is often associated with mystery, power, and elegance. It can represent darkness, the unknown, and even authority. In art, black paint is commonly used to convey depth, contrast, and intensity. It can also symbolize a sense of rebellion or non-conformity.

Why do artists choose to use black paint in their artwork?

Artists may choose to use black paint for various reasons. It can be used to create a dramatic effect, to enhance the visibility of other colors, or to represent the absence of light. Black paint can also be used to convey emotions such as sadness, mystery, or intensity.

Are there any cultural or historical significance associated with black paint?

Black has different cultural and historical significances across various societies. In some cultures, black is associated with mourning and death, while in others it represents power and authority. Throughout history, black has been used to symbolize rebellion, as seen in the black clothing worn by punk and gothic subcultures.

Can black paint have a positive meaning or symbolism?

While black is often associated with negative connotations, it can also have positive meanings. In some contexts, black can represent sophistication, elegance, and formality. In fashion, black is often considered timeless and chic. Additionally, black can symbolize strength and resilience in overcoming challenges.

What are some famous artworks that prominently feature black paint?

There are several well-known artworks that prominently feature black paint. One example is Kazimir Malevich's "Black Square," a minimalist painting from 1915 that represents the pinnacle of the artist's Suprematist movement. Another example is Mark Rothko's abstract expressionist paintings, which often utilize black as a primary color to evoke deep emotional responses.
